Written and directed by Giri Palika, Bangaru Bullodu features Allari Naresh and Pooja Jhaveri in lead roles. This movie is Giri Palika’s second directorial after Nandini Nursing home. He also happened to write the story for Trikoti’s directorial Dikkulu Choodaku Ramayya. One can expect an out and out entertainment ride from the recently released trailer of Bangaru Bullodu. Allari Naresh seemed to have gone by his trademark comedy which he is best at. Let us get a flair of what Bangaru Bullodu is all about.
A simple story narrated in the most humorous way
Bhavani Prasad (Allari Naresh) is a bank employee at a village and has issues with his two brothers. Bhavani Prasad’s grandfather robs jewellery for an important cause from a village temple. Bhavani Prasad uses the jewellery from his bank locker to fix his grandfather’s issues. However, things get a serious turn when the owner of jewellery asks for his ornaments. How Bhavani Prasad deals with the mess, he got into forms the rest.
Bangaru Bullodu banks on Allari Naresh and his antics
It is Allari Naresh’s show all the way. Bangaru Bullodu is filled with situational comedy, and Allari Naresh was at his usual best. He is well supported by many comedians such as Pritvi, Praveen, Prabhas Srinu, Venella Kishore, Satyam Rajesh, Tanikella Bharani and Posani Krishna Murali. Ajay Ghosh was apt in the role of a cop. Pooja Jhaveri shined in her role, which had good comedy and was also looking glamorous. The song Swathilo Muthyamantha was well remixed.
The technical crew has put in their best
Giri Palika attempted a whole length comedy entertainer set in a village backdrop and successfully got the end product right. It was refreshing to see a wholesome comedy movie with a rural backdrop after a long time. Most probably, for Allari Naresh, the last he attempted was Bendu Apparao. The music and background score by Sai Kartheek complemented the tone of the movie. Satish Muthyala’s visuals are a feast, and the village backdrop is well captured. Editing by MR Varma is crisp and pitch-perfect. Production values from AK Entertainments banner are good.

Director: Giri Palika
Writer: Giri Palika
Cast: Allari Naresh, Pooja Jhaveri, Tanikella Bharani, Posani Krishna Murali, Prithvi, Praveen, Vennela Kishore, Satyam Rajesh, Prabhas Srinu, Jabardasth Mahesh, Anant, Bhadram, Ajay Ghosh, and Saarika Ramachandra Rao.
Music: Sai Kartheek
Background Score: Sai Kartheek
Cinematography: Satish Muthyala
Language: Telugu
